What Is Stone Carpet Flooring?

Stone Carpet is a decorative flooring system made from natural quartz stones bonded together with a specialized resin. Unlike traditional carpets that use fabric or synthetic fibers, Stone Carpet creates a seamless and durable surface that can be used indoors and outdoors. The natural quartz stones come in a variety of colors and textures, allowing for a customized design to match any aesthetic.

Stone Carpet is commonly used in high-traffic areas due to its slip-resistant, stain-resistant, and wear-resistant properties. This makes it an excellent choice for spaces like:

  • Retail stores
  • Hotels and restaurants
  • Showrooms
  • Pool decks and patios
  • Garage floors
  • Office buildings

How Does Stone Carpet Flooring Work?

The installation process of Stone Carpet flooring involves several steps to ensure a strong, durable, and long-lasting finish. Hereโ€™s how it works:

1. Surface Preparation

Before applying Stone Carpet, the existing floor surface must be cleaned and prepped. Any dust, grease, or debris is removed to create a smooth base for application. Depending on the condition of the floor, a primer may be applied to improve adhesion.

2. Application of Stone and Resin Mixture

Once the surface is prepared, a mixture of natural quartz stones and a high-quality resin binder is applied evenly across the area. This resin acts as a strong adhesive, holding the stones together while creating a seamless and flexible flooring system.

3. Smoothing and Leveling

The Stone Carpet is then spread and leveled using a specialized trowel to ensure a uniform thickness. This step is crucial in achieving a polished and professional finish.

4. Curing Process

After installation, the floor is left to cure for several hours, allowing the resin to bond securely with the stones. The curing process ensures maximum durability and a solid, long-lasting surface.

5. Sealing and Finishing (Optional)

A final sealant coat may be applied for added protection against stains, moisture, and UV exposure, making it especially beneficial for outdoor applications.


Benefits of Stone Carpet Flooring

1. Highly Durable and Long-Lasting

Stone Carpet is built to withstand heavy foot traffic, extreme weather conditions, and impact. Unlike traditional flooring materials, it does not crack, chip, or fade over time.

2. Slip-Resistant for Safety

One of the key benefits of Stone Carpet is its anti-slip surface, making it ideal for areas like pool decks, patios, and commercial entryways where safety is a priority.

3. Low Maintenance

Unlike traditional carpets that trap dust and allergens, Stone Carpet is easy to clean with simple vacuuming and occasional washing.

4. Aesthetic Versatility

Stone Carpet comes in a wide range of colors and finishes, allowing for custom designs that match any interior or exterior decor.

5. Eco-Friendly Option

Since Stone Carpet is made of natural materials, it is an environmentally friendly flooring option. It also improves indoor air quality by reducing dust accumulation.
